Czech Word of the Day

ráno

/RA-no/ • noun / adverb — 14th of Jun, 2026

Meaning: morning; the time of day from waking until around noon

Examples

  1. Ráno piju kávu.
    (In the morning I drink coffee.)
  2. Dobré ráno! Jak ses vyspal?
    (Good morning! Did you sleep well?)
  3. Zítra ráno odjíždím v sedm.
    (Tomorrow morning I leave at seven.)

Synonyms

  • jitro
  • dopoledne
Ráno is used both as a noun and an adverb to indicate the morning time. It appears in greetings (Dobré ráno = Good morning) and before verbs to mark when something happens (Ráno vstávám v sedm = I get up at seven in the morning). It usually refers to the period up to around noon; dopoledne is more specifically 'before noon' and jitro is a more poetic synonym. Pronounce with stress on the first syllable: RA-no.
